Pamplona
Internationally known for hosting the festival of San Fermín, Pamplona is a city full of life all three hundred and sixty-five days of the year. Pamplona offers history, gastronomy, culture, art, sport, natural spaces… and an endless number of activities involving tourists as well as locals, known as “pamplonicas”.
San Fermín
From July 6 to 14, Pamplona is transformed to make way for what is considered the best fiesta in the world. Starting with the txupinazo, the city is dyed white and red to make way for hundreds of events for all audiences, ending with the Pobre de mí. The procession honoring the saint, processions of giants and big-heads, concerts, regional folklore… And, of course, the traditional bull festivities. An unforgettable experience for those who experience it.


Camino de Santiago (the Way of St. James)
Pamplona is crossed by pilgrims on their way along the French Way. Along a route of approximately 2 kilometres, the city’s main landmarks are discovered: the city walls, the cathedral, the streest of Estafeta and Mercaderes, Taconera Gardens and the Citadel.

Gastronomy
Navarre’s cultural and natural wealth has been key to its gastronomic success. Excellent vegetables from its orchards, Designation of Origin wines or artisan products make up a diverse and surprising menu.
Nature
In a small area, Navarre offers a varied and surprising landscape from the peaks of the Pyrenees in the north, to the southern desert, Bardenas Reales. Its forests, gorges, lakes, caves and natural parks, the place is ideal for those seeking to enjoy nature on their journey.
